Inclusions
What’s covered?Accidental Death Coverage
Pays agreed amount in case of accidental bodily injury resulting in Death within 12 months from accident date
Permanent Total Disability (PTD) Cover
Pays agreed amount in case of accidental bodily injury resulting in PTD within 12 months from accident date
Permanent Partial Disability (PPD) Cover
Pays agreed amount in case of an accidental bodily injury resulting in PPD within 12 months from accident date
Temporary Total Disability (TTD) Cover
If an accident temporarily prevents you from working, the policy may offer weekly benefits to compensate for lost income during the recovery period for maximum 100 weeks
Transportation of Mortal Remains Cover
Pays agreed amount towards expenses of transporting mortal remains in case of accidental death
Lifestyle Modification Benefit
Pays agreed amount in case of PTD, PPD towards lifestyle modification to help you adjust to new circumstances
Disappearance
Pays Death Cover sum insured if insured person is declared as disappeared as per terms & conditions

Exclusions
What’s not covered?Intoxication
While under the influence of liquor or drugs, alcohol or other intoxicants
Participation in hazardous activities
While engaged in any hazardous activity unless specifically insured
Self Inflicted Acts
Self-inflicted injuries, suicide attempts, insanity and illegal acts
Adventure Sports Benefit
Whilst engaging in Adventure Sports unless specifically insured
War & Related Perils
The policy does not cover any incidents related to war, civil war, invasion, rebellion, revolution, military actions, or government orders

Workmen's compensation insurance usually covers medical expenses, wage loss, and disability benefits for employees injured at work. It provides compensation for temporary or permanent disabilities among other things. This insurance ensures that employees receive prompt financial support while employers meet statutory legal requirements.
Employers in industries with higher risk levels, such as construction, manufacturing, or mining, are legally required to have workmen's compensation insurance. This coverage protects both full-time and temporary employees from financial hardships due to workplace injuries, ensuring compliance with labour laws and promoting a safe work environment.
When an employee is injured, the claim process starts with prompt notification to the insurer. The employee must submit a claim form along with medical reports and incident details. The insurer verifies the documentation, assesses the claim, and then processes compensation ensuring timely financial relief for the worker.
Essential documents include a duly filled claim form, medical reports, accident or incident reports, proof of employment, and any other relevant documents such as FIR or police reports in case of a major incident. Accurate documentation helps the insurer verify the claim and expedite the compensation process for the injured employee.
Yes, workmen's compensation insurance can cover temporary & contractual employees as well. Employers often extend this coverage to all workers to comply with legal requirements & protect everyone on the job site. This inclusive approach ensures that all employees receive necessary financial support and medical benefits in the event of an accident.
Employee compensation insurance provides financial protection for employees who suffer work-related injuries or illnesses. It covers medical expenses, lost wages, and rehabilitation costs.
Employers in high-risk industries such as construction, manufacturing, and mining are typically required by law to have employee compensation insurance. This ensures that employees are protected in case of workplace accidents.
The insurance covers injuries sustained during the course of employment, including accidents, repetitive stress injuries, and occupational diseases. It also covers injuries that occur off-site if they are work-related.
Most policies cover full-time, part-time, and temporary employees. However, coverage details can vary from one policy to another, so it's important to review the specific terms of the policy.
This insurance helps employers comply with legal requirements, reduces the risk of lawsuits, and promotes a safer work environment.
Notify your employer immediately after the injury occurs. Fill out a claim form and submit it along with medical reports and any other required documentation to the insurer.
Essential documents needed to file a claim under employee compensation insurance include a completed claim form, medical reports, accident or incident reports, proof of employment, and any other relevant documents such as police reports in case of a major incident.
The processing time can vary depending on the complexity of the claim and the relevance & accuracy of the documentation provided. Prompt reporting and submission of all required documents can expedite the process.
If your claim is denied, review the reasons provided by the insurer. You can appeal the decision by providing additional evidence or documentation to support your claim.
Common exclusions include injuries resulting from intentional misconduct, self-inflicted injuries, and injuries sustained while under the influence of drugs or alcohol. Always review your policy for specific exclusions.
Contact your insurer before the policy expiration date to discuss renewal options. Review your coverage needs and make any necessary adjustments to the policy.
Yes, you can update your policy to reflect any changes in your business operations, such as new job roles, increased workforce, or additional coverage needs.
Consider changes in your workforce, job roles, and any new risks that may have emerged. Review your past claims and adjust coverage limits as needed at the time of renewal as well.
Some insurers may offer a grace period, but there’s no guarantee. It’s important to renew your policy before it expires to avoid any gaps in coverage.
No, you can’t switch the insurer for your existing employee insurance. However, you may get a new policy with a different insurer at the time of renewal if needed. Ensure there is no lapse in coverage during the transition.
